Rajcic Selected on Day Two of 2022 MLB Draft

Jul 18, 2022
Max Rajcic (photo: Mika Salazar)

LOS ANGELES – UCLA sophomore right-hander Max Rajcic was selected in the sixth round of the 2022 MLB Draft by the St. Louis Cardinals on Monday afternoon.

Rajcic becomes the 118th Bruin to be picked in the MLB Draft in 18 years under head coach John Savage. The Fullerton, Calif. native was the No. 187 overall selection in the 2022 MLB Draft.

Rajcic is coming off a strong two-year run in Westwood, making the Pac-12 All-Conference Team in each of the last two seasons. Combined, he's accrued a 10-6 record, 2.83 ERA, .212 batting average against, and 128 strikeouts over 117 2/3 innings

As a freshman in 2021, Rajcic served as the team's closer and pitched to a 1.65 ERA en route to Freshman All-America honors. In addition, he tied a freshman program record with seven saves.

Rajcic made a successful transition to the weekend rotation for the 2022 season, going 8-5 with a 3.28 ERA and 92 strikeouts in 85 innings on the way to All-Pac-12 and All-West Region accolades. He ranked top-five in the Pac-12 in wins, WHIP (1.09), ERA, and strikeouts, and was a two-time Pac-12 Pitcher of the Week. After starting off the year as the Saturday starter, he ascended to the Friday night role by year's end, starting the Bruins' Auburn Regional-opener against Florida State on Jun. 3.

His signature outing of the year came on May 13 against Washington State, as he struck out a career-high 14 batters while walking none and completing the first eight innings of a combined one-hitter. With that effort, he became the first Bruin pitcher under Coach Savage to strike out at least 14 batters in a game without issuing a walk. Rajcic was recognized as the National Pitcher of the Week by Perfect Game and the NCBWA after his gem against the Cougars.

In addition to Rajcic, a pair of UCLA commits have been picked over the first two days of the MLB Draft. Right-handed pitcher Ian Ritchie Jr. (Bainbridge HS / Bainbridge Island, Wash.) was selected No. 35 overall by the Atlanta Braves in Competitive Balance Round A, while infielder Chris Paciolla (Temecula Valley HS / Temecula, Calif.) was a third-round choice of the Chicago Cubs.
